ITM Achievement Awards

The ITM Achievement Awards return for a second year 

Celebrating excellence across the travel community and recognising mentees as they graduate from the ITM Mentoring Programme, the event promises to be a rewarding afternoon and provides a perfect opportunity to network.

The Awards & Finalists

Category - General
- Game Changer (Individual)

Shelley Fletcher-Bryant | Advito
Tiffany Casson | Inntel Ltd
Dennis Vilovic | Troop


- Game Changer (Team)
KPMG / AMEX GBT
Global Secure Accreditation
agiito
TripStax

This year's Game Changer awards will recognise the exceptional drive, bold approach and confidence to pursue change to overcome a company, client or industry challenge.

- Programme Achievement (Individual)

Kim Trenter | DAZN
Neil Woodliffe | Clarivate
Ann Thomas | agiito


- Programme Achievement (Team)
NES Fircroft (x2)
agiito
CISCO


This award will recognise the step changes made in Travel/Travel & Meetings & Expense Programmes to bring maximum value to the end-to-end experience. It could be a single piece of the puzzle, a re-design of the programme, technology-based or a re-focus of the resource in place.

- Service Excellence (Individual)
Lindsay Cook | agiito
John Blackburn | CTM
Evette Desigar | AMEX GBT
Matthew McCrudden | agiito


- Service Excellence (Team)
Crisis24 Integrated Risk Management Solution
Silverdoor
Synergy Global Housing
agiito

Recognising the focus and dedication needed to deliver excellence over the last year, this award will shine a light on the individual, and teams, that have demonstrated best-in-class delivery of a Travel/Travel & Meetings & Expense Programme.

Category - ITM Mentoring Programme
- Mentor of the Year
Leanne Fowler | agiito
Sam McKnight | CIBTvisas
Sue Jones | IKEA 

This award recognises this mentor's commitment to supporting the industry and future talent through sharing their expertise to guide and develop the mentees they have worked with.

- Mentee of the Year
James Diaz | Travel Planet
Katie Garrahy | Silverdoor Apartments
Sarah Whiting | BCD Travel

This award recognises this mentee's investment in the ITM Mentoring Programme, and themselves, through working with their mentor. 

- One to Watch (Mentee) 
The winner of this award will be announced at the event. 

The ITM Mentoring Team recognise a mentee who has excelled on their journey with their mentor.

The awards will conclude with the Mentoring Programme Graduation.
